This undated photo provided by the Oregon Coast Aquarium shows a northern sea otter, rescued in Alaska as a pup, who died Wednesday, March 6, 2013 at the aquarium at age 14. Officials at the Oregon Coast Aquarium in Newport say cutting edge surgery performed on a northern sea otter from Alaska bought the marine mammal an extra two years of pain-free life.
